RATHDRUM, Idaho -- Crime Stoppers of the Inland Northwest is offering a $500 reward for information about a northern Idaho woman who was reported missing more than seven years ago.

Deborah Dee Sykes was last seen sleeping at her Rathdrum home on Feb. 13, 2005. She was 38 at the time, and would be 45 today. Rathdrum Police Chief Kevin Fuhr told the Coeur d'Alene Press that the case is intriguing because Sykes left a husband and a son behind, along with all her belongings. He said there was no indication of strained family relationships.

Sykes is described as white and 5 feet, 8 inches tall, weighing about 125 pounds with brown hair and hazel eyes. She has discolored teeth.

Sykes' family is also offering an undisclosed reward amount.
